Drosh vs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Drosh, Pakistan and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ma, Usa is approximately 10,580 km or 6,574 mi.
  • To reach Drosh in this distance one would set out from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ma bearing 29.5°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Drosh bearing 153.3° or SSE .
  • Drosh has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
  • Drosh is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 8.4 °C (15.1°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 0 °C (0°F) more in Drosh.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 655.3 mm (25.8 in) less which is equivalent to 655.3 l/m² (16.08 US gal/ft²) or 6,553,000 l/ha (700,559 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.6° higher in Drosh than in Milton/ Blue Hill, Ma.
